Community Leaders, Others Protest Removal, Appointment of King in Edo
[NigerianEye - Nigeria] - 11/06/2025
Tensions are rising in Okpella, Etsako East Local Government Area of Edo State, as members of the community—including the elderly and physically challenged—staged a protest on Wednesday against the removal of their traditional ruler and the alleged illegal appointment of a new one.The protesters, mostly from the Ukhomunyo community, marched to both the Edo State Government House and the palace of the Oba of Benin, carrying placards denouncing what they described as the unlawful removal of the Okuokpellagbe of Okpella and the planned installation of a successor next month.They also objected (…)
